Physical and PsychicalMany efforts have been made by physicists to account for the facts, the most generally accepted theory being the Young Helmholtz theory, hich starts from the existence of three primary colour-qnnlitiey - red. Green, and violet. It is argued that since the mixture of these in right proportions gives all the colour-qualities at a relatively great degree of saturation, there fore there are three elementary stimulations and three primary sensations corresponding to them. These stimulations are made possible by the functions (according to Young) of three kinds of nerve-fibrils, or (according to Helmholtz) of three chemical substances. The sensation of red is the result of the stimulation of one, the sensation of green the result of another, and violet of a third. Now. Light excites all three of these nerve-fibrils or substances, but with different intensity. According to the wave length.
